Skills Alliance is seeking an experienced pharmaceutical manufacturing procurement expert, ahead of a busy project schedule across global business needs. They require a contractor to join on an initial 9 month engagement (likely to extend).

 

Role Objectives:

The global procurement manager will lead sourcing & procurement activities for Active Pharmaceutical Ingredients (API's), Formulation & Packaging (F&P), categories of external manufacturing, for both small molecule and biologics therapy areas across a highly complex, global business. You will be responsible for leading commercial procurement activities with assigned suppliers, and for assigned brands within a therapy area in support of therapy area leadership within the team.

In conjunction with other team members, you will develop long term strategies on two dimensions:

  • For brands, working with Therapy Leads to drive end-to-end supply chain value, as well as full product lifecycle value;
  • For technologies, developing API and F&P category strategies. Ultimately ensuring that the external supply base can support these strategies well into the future.

Required Experience:

  • Minimum 7 years in Pharmaceutical Procurement – in one or more of the following areas: Active Pharmaceutical Ingredient (API) / Bio drug substances / Formulation & Packaging (F&P), clinical manufacturing.
  • Experience of sourcing contract manufacturing services advantageous
  • Strong experience in Supplier selection & strong negotiation strategy
  • Stakeholder Management – Stakeholder Negotiation / advisory / Influencing.
  • Comfort with risk and ambiguous situations. Ability to work in fast paced moving environment managing multiple scenarios.
  • Commercial, Procurement experience, negotiating large, complex deals.
  • Experience of working on global basis.
  • Analytical and Systems acumen, working with Procure-to-pay systems, SAP, Microsoft Suite
  • Sound understanding of Safety, Health and Environment
  • Project management, change management and strong collaboration skills.
  • Excellent collaborator 
  • Degree level or equivalent qualifications
